-- Fundamental types
type Path = [Int]
type Node t = (Path, t)
class Foldable tree => IsTree tree where
-- | Direct subtrees of a tree
subtrees :: tree t -> [tree t]
subtrees = fst . uniplate
uniplate :: tree t -> ([tree t], [tree t] -> tree t)
emptyNode :: tree t
toksAfter :: Foldable t1 => t -> t1 a -> [a]
toksAfter _begin = allToks
allToks :: Foldable t => t a -> [a]
allToks = toList
tokAtOrBefore :: Foldable t => Point -> t (Tok t1) -> Maybe (Tok t1)
tokAtOrBefore p res =
listToMaybe $ reverse $ toksInRegion (mkRegion 0 (p+1)) res
toksInRegion :: Foldable t1 => Region -> t1 (Tok t) -> [Tok t]
toksInRegion reg = takeWhile (\t -> tokBegin t <= regionEnd reg)
. dropWhile (\t -> tokEnd t < regionStart reg)
. toksAfter (regionStart reg)
tokenBasedAnnots :: (Foldable t1) => (a1 -> Maybe a) -> t1 a1 -> t -> [a]
tokenBasedAnnots tta t begin = catMaybes (tta <$> toksAfter begin t)
tokenBasedStrokes :: (Foldable t3) => (a -> b) -> t3 a -> t -> t2 -> t1 -> [b]
tokenBasedStrokes tts t _point begin _end = tts <$> toksAfter begin t

-- | Return the first element that matches the predicate, or the last
-- of the list if none matches.
firstThat :: (a -> Bool) -> NonEmpty a -> a
firstThat _ (x :| []) = x
firstThat p (x :| [y]) = if p x then x else y
firstThat p (x :| y : xs) = if p x then x else firstThat p (y :| xs)
-- | Return the element before first element that violates the
-- predicate, or the first of the list if that one violates the
-- predicate.
lastThat :: (a -> Bool) -> NonEmpty a -> a
lastThat p (x :| xs) = if p x then work x xs else x
where work x0 [] = x0
work x0 (y:ys) = if p y then work y ys else x0

-- | Return all leaves (with paths) inside a given root.
allLeavesIn :: (IsTree tree) => (Int -> [(Int, tree a)] -> [(Int, tree a)])
-> tree a -> [Node (tree a)]
allLeavesIn select = allLeavesRelativeChild select (-1)
-- | Return all subtrees in a tree; each element of the return list
-- contains paths to nodes. (Root is at the start of each path)
getAllPaths :: IsTree tree => tree t -> [[tree t]]
getAllPaths t = fmap (<>[t]) ([] : concatMap getAllPaths (subtrees t))
goDown :: IsTree tree => Int -> tree t -> Maybe (tree t)
goDown i = index i . subtrees
index :: Int -> [a] -> Maybe a
index _ [] = Nothing
index 0 (h:_) = Just h
index n (_:t) = index (n-1) t
walkDown :: IsTree tree => Node (tree t) -> Maybe (tree t)
walkDown ([],t) = return t
walkDown (x:xs,t) = goDown x t >>= curry walkDown xs
wkDown :: IsTree tree => Node (tree a) -> Node (tree a)
wkDown ([],t) = ([],t)
wkDown (x:xs,t) = case goDown x t of
Nothing -> ([],t)
Just t' -> first (x:) $ wkDown (xs,t')
-- | Search the given list, and return the last tree before the given
-- point; with path to the root. (Root is at the start of the path)
getLastPath :: IsTree tree => [tree (Tok t)] -> Point -> Maybe [tree (Tok t)]
getLastPath roots offset =
case takeWhile ((< offset) . posnOfs . snd) allSubPathPosn of
[] -> Nothing
xs -> Just $ fst $ last xs
where
allSubPathPosn = [ (p,posn) | root <- roots
, p@(t':_) <- getAllPaths root
, Just tok <- [getFirstElement t']
, let posn = tokPosn tok
]
-- | Return all subtrees in a tree, in preorder.
getAllSubTrees :: IsTree tree => tree t -> [tree t]
getAllSubTrees t = t : concatMap getAllSubTrees (subtrees t)
-- | Return the 1st token of a subtree.
getFirstElement :: Foldable t => t a -> Maybe a
getFirstElement tree = getFirst $ foldMap (First . Just) tree
nullSubtree :: Foldable t => t a -> Bool
nullSubtree = null . toList
getFirstTok, getLastTok :: Foldable t => t a -> Maybe a
getFirstTok = getFirstElement
getLastTok = getLastElement
-- | Return the last token of a subtree.
getLastElement :: Foldable t => t a -> Maybe a
getLastElement tree = getLast $ foldMap (Last . Just) tree
getFirstOffset, getLastOffset :: Foldable t => t (Tok t1) -> Point
getFirstOffset = maybe 0 tokBegin . getFirstTok
getLastOffset = maybe 0 tokEnd . getLastTok
subtreeRegion :: Foldable t => t (Tok t1) -> Region
subtreeRegion t = mkRegion (getFirstOffset t) (getLastOffset t)
-- | Given a tree, return (first offset, number of lines).
getSubtreeSpan :: (Foldable tree) => tree (Tok t) -> (Point, Int)
getSubtreeSpan tree = (posnOfs firstOff, lastLine - firstLine)
where bounds@[firstOff, _last] = fmap (tokPosn . assertJust)
[getFirstElement tree, getLastElement tree]
[firstLine, lastLine] = fmap posnLine bounds
assertJust (Just x) = x
assertJust _ = error "assertJust: Just expected"
-------------------------------------
-- Should be in Control.Applicative.?
sepBy :: (Alternative f) => f a -> f v -> f [a]
sepBy p s = sepBy1 p s <|> pure []
sepBy1 :: (Alternative f) => f a -> f v -> f [a]
sepBy1 p s = (:) <$> p <*> many (s *> p)
